Justin Verlander strikes out nine in his last start of 2015

Justin Verlander (SP - HOU)

Justin Verlander pitched six innings on Saturday, and surrendered two earned runs on five hits while giving up one walk and striking out nine. He was not in line for a decision in the 4-3 loss, even before Neftali Feliz blew the save. (ESPN)

Fantasy Impact
Verlander completed a pretty remarkable season, as he struggled out of the gate but rebounded in a big way. I do not know if many thought a rebound was possible for the 32-year-old, due to the possibility of him being finished because of massive workloads in previous seasons. However, after starting his season with a horrible June and a poor July, Verlander turned it on. He got his velocity back, flirted with a no-hitter, and put together three solid months. Over the final three months, he did not have an individual month's ERA higher than 3.27 and recorded a strikeout-to-walk ratio of 78:20.
